首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我正在尝试更改Dash应用程序的布局

我了解您的需求,我将尽力为您提供关于更改Dash应用程序布局的完善且全面的答案。以下是我对这个问题的回答:

更改Dash应用程序的布局是指调整Dash应用程序中各个组件的排列方式和样式,以实现更好的用户体验和界面设计。下面是一些常见的布局调整方法和技术:

  1. 使用Dash的布局组件:Dash提供了一些内置的布局组件,如html.Divhtml.Spanhtml.Section等,可以通过这些组件来构建应用程序的布局结构。您可以根据需要嵌套使用这些组件,来实现不同的布局效果。
  2. 使用CSS样式:Dash应用程序支持使用CSS样式来自定义组件的外观和布局。您可以通过为组件添加CSS类或内联样式来调整其大小、位置、颜色等属性。可以使用style属性或className属性来应用CSS样式。
  3. 使用Bootstrap框架:Dash应用程序可以集成Bootstrap框架,通过使用Bootstrap的栅格系统和CSS类,可以更方便地实现响应式布局和网格布局。您可以使用Bootstrap提供的容器、行、列等组件来构建应用程序的布局结构。
  4. 使用Dash的回调函数:Dash的回调函数可以根据用户的交互动作来动态改变组件的布局。您可以根据用户的选择或输入,通过回调函数来更新组件的属性,从而实现布局的变化。
  5. 使用Dash的插件和扩展:Dash社区提供了许多有用的插件和扩展,可以帮助您更快速地实现特定的布局效果。您可以在Dash的官方文档或Dash的社区论坛中查找相关的插件和扩展。

对于Dash应用程序布局的优势,它可以提供灵活性和可定制性,使开发人员能够根据具体需求设计和调整应用程序的界面。通过合理的布局设计,可以提高用户的使用体验和界面的美观度。

关于应用场景,Dash应用程序布局的调整适用于各种类型的Web应用程序,包括数据可视化、仪表盘、报表、监控系统等。无论是企业内部使用还是对外展示,都可以根据具体需求进行布局的调整。

以下是一些腾讯云相关产品和产品介绍链接地址,可以帮助您更好地实现和部署Dash应用程序:

  1. 腾讯云云服务器(CVM):提供可扩展的云服务器实例,用于部署和运行Dash应用程序。详情请参考:腾讯云云服务器
  2. 腾讯云对象存储(COS):用于存储和管理Dash应用程序中的静态文件,如图像、样式表和脚本文件等。详情请参考:腾讯云对象存储
  3. 腾讯云内容分发网络(CDN):加速Dash应用程序的访问速度,提供更好的用户体验。详情请参考:腾讯云内容分发网络

请注意,以上提到的腾讯云产品仅作为示例,您可以根据实际需求选择适合的产品和服务。

希望以上回答能够满足您的需求,如果您有任何其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

最受欢迎的AI数据工具Plotly Dash简介

Plotly Dash 是一款支持数据应用程序的 Python 图表展示工具。它作为 AI 工具越来越受欢迎,因此这里提供我们的入门指南。...Python 是数据分析,甚至在一定程度上是 AI 开发的首选语言。Plotly Dash 是一款用于支持数据应用程序的演示图表工具。...或者用他们的话来说,“Dash 是一个原始的低代码框架,用于在 Python 中快速构建数据应用程序。” 但与往常一样,低代码仍然需要对编程有合理的理解。...在创建 app.py 文件并运行它之后,最终我得到了一个响应: 因此,查看本地地址上声明的本地站点,我看到了: 请注意,“加拿大”是下拉菜单中的默认选择,如果我选择另一个国家,图表会立即更改。...然而,感觉它并不完全标准化,因此您需要阅读您想要尝试的每个组件的说明。但我建议您在下次想要展示一些数据时尝试一下。

11910

Python可视化Dash教程简译(二)

Dash是基于Flask的Python可视化工具,我在学习之余尝试着翻译官方的Tutorial,有不足之处,还望不吝指正” Dash Callbacks 本章节描述了如何使Dash应用程序具有可交互性...我们应用程序的输入(Input)和输出(Output)接口,都是通过装饰器app.callback来方式声明的。 2. 在Dash里,我们应用程序的输入和输出只是特定组件的属性。...请注意我们时怎么在布局中给my-div组件的children属性赋值的,当Dash程序启动时,它会自动使用输入组件的初始值来调用回调函数,以填充输出组件的初始状态。...如果更改了国家/地区的RadioItems组件的值,Dash将会等待,直到cities组件的值也被更新了,才会调用最终的回调函数。...综述 我们已经介绍了Dash中回调函数的基本原理,Dash应用程序是基于一系列简单但是强大的原则构建的:声明UI,可以通过反应性和功能性Python回调函数来自定义。

5.7K20
  • 使用Dash和Plotly进行交互式可视化

    matplotlib的所有图表类型等等。 https://plot.ly/python/ Dash也是同一家公司的另一个产品,为Python构建基于Web的应用程序提供了框架。...如果正在与团队合作或只是想与他人分享工作,那么Web应用程序是最简单的方法,可以消除库版本或界面问题。 在这篇文章中,将了解这两个库如何成为探索性数据分析的良好解决方案。...一个简单的短跑应用程序 下面是一个简单的dash Web应用程序,由六行代码组成。只需将其写入.py文件并调用该文件,应用程序即可运行。...在代码的前两行中,只需导入所需的dash库。第三行初始化dash应用程序,第四行使用将在页面上显示的标题标记准备页面布局,最后两行使用调试和端口选项运行服务器。 首先放置所需的元素。...以下行是图表的布局属性。 代码已准备好运行。

    8.5K30

    Python交互式数据可视化:使用Dash构建强大的Web应用程序

    安装Dash首先,确保你已经安装了Dash和Plotly:pip install dash plotly创建一个简单的Dash应用程序下面是一个简单的Dash应用程序示例,它包含一个简单的布局和一个交互式的图表...as gofrom dash.dependencies import Input, Output​# 创建Dash应用程序app = dash.Dash(__name__)​# 定义应用程序布局app.layout...(__name__)​# 定义应用程序布局app.layout = html.Div([ html.H1('进阶交互式数据可视化'), dcc.Graph(id='advanced-graph...通过阅读和学习示例代码,你可以借鉴他们的经验和技巧,加快自己的学习和开发进度。4. 实战项目尝试从头开始构建一个真实的Dash应用程序项目。选择一个感兴趣的主题或领域,然后设定目标并开始开发。...定期阅读相关的技术博客、参加线上或线下的技术活动,以及尝试新的工具和技术,都可以帮助你保持在这个领域的竞争力。总结本文深入探讨了使用Dash框架构建交互式Web应用程序的指南。

    84110

    使用Plotly Dash创建交互式仪表板的步骤和技巧

    创建应用程序接下来,创建一个 Dash 应用程序。app = dash.Dash(__name__)3. 设计布局使用 HTML 和 Dash 组件来设计你的仪表板布局。...= dash.Dash(__name__)​app.layout = html.Div(children=[ html.H1('我的数据仪表板'), dcc.Markdown('''...使用回调函数利用 Dash 的回调函数,可以实现根据用户的交互动作更新图表或布局。...的文件,列出你的应用程序所需的所有依赖包:dash gunicorn使用 Git 将你的应用程序代码推送到一个新的 GitHub 存储库。...总结在本文中,我们深入探讨了如何使用 Plotly Dash 创建仪表板的步骤和一些技巧。我们从导入必要的库开始,创建了一个基本的 Dash 应用程序,并设计了仪表板的布局。

    58320

    如何为Ubuntu Dock图标启用最小化点击功能?

    我已经习惯了这个特性,我想让它回到我的Ubuntu 18.04桌面。如果你想在你的Ubuntu Dock上启用这个功能,请遵循下面的步骤。...方法1  – 使用gsettings命令 gsettings是gsettings的命令行接口,它允许我们获取、设置或监视单击键的更改。 这是启用“点击最小化”功能的最快方法。...启用此功能后,单击正在运行的应用程序的图标,它将立即最小化以停靠。 如果要预览是否打开了相同应用程序的多个窗口,请改用以下命令: 当您单击正在运行的应用程序时,它将显示所有打开的窗口的预览。...如果只有一个应用程序的实例正在运行,它将最小化它以停靠。 如下图: 只要点击任何一个窗口,就可以把它打开。这是我喜欢的方式。...现在,通过单击任何正在运行的应用程序的图标来验证是否启用了“最小化点击”功能,您将看到相应的应用程序被自动最小化以停靠。

    1.7K10

    Ubuntu 17.10 已经发布,图解新功能

    简介: Ubuntu 17.10是对这个基于Linux操作系统的一个很大的升级。它使用新的桌面外壳,新的显示服务器技术,并对主要用户界面和用户体验更改。...将突出显示打开的窗口。将鼠标悬停在窗口上以查看窗口标题,并显示快速关闭按钮,或单击缩略图以转到该应用程序。 该活动 屏幕将显示所有正在运行的应用程序的窗口,甚至是最小化的。...可以一目了然的看到更多的已安装的软件,而不是Unity Dash中提供的截图。 应用程序按字母顺序排列,可滚动页面。...技术正在成熟,Wayland在某些硬件上; 当尝试运行较旧的应用程序或播放高分辨率游戏时; 或者当您附加某些类型的输入设备或显示器时,会出现错误 发生这种情况,请不要惊慌: Ubuntu 17.10默认情况下还包括...应用程序中包含的各种设置面板也进行了重新设置,以遵循类似的布局和模式。

    1.8K90

    使用 HuggingFace Transformers创建自己的搜索引擎

    在本教程中,我将解释如何使用HuggingFace Transformers库、Non-Metric Space库和Dash库来构建一个新的和改进的自动侍酒师。...注意:将所有文本转换为矢量可能需要一些时间,所以如果你只是想尝试一下,我建议只使用20,000条记录来快速训练。 HuggingFace?...安装Dash、Dash Bootstrap组件和jupyter- Dash,如果你想在jupyter笔记本中构建一个Dash应用程序。...in a jupyter notebook Dash应用程序由布局和回调组成: 布局:布局由描述应用程序外观和用户如何体验内容的组件树组成。...通过像HuggingFace这样的框架来利用最先进的语言模型的强大力量,为像我这样的机器学习爱好者打开了一扇门,他们可以只用几行代码就构建出一些很棒的应用程序。

    3.7K40

    推荐一个牛逼的生物信息 Python 库 - Dash Bio

    图片来源:theinDelphi CRISPR prediction app 同样,南卡罗来纳医科大学的 Hammer 实验室正在开发一种带有 Dash 的开源细胞显微镜工具,并在 bioRxiv 上发表了他们的方法...今年,Plotly 正在利用 Dash Bio 重建其对生命科学的承诺 - Dash Bio 是一个用于在Python 中构建生物信息学和药物开发应用程序的开源工具包。...由于 Dash 是开源的,因此整个软件应用程序的代码可以以同行评审的方式自由分发和发布。...当您单击原子,旋转分子或更改结构时,Dash 会触发 Python 回调函数。您还可以突出显示单个原子(如蛋白质的活性位点)。...在下面的 Dash 应用程序中,21 个染色体以圆圈绘制,并且它们的基因组区域之间的关系与线或带相关联。

    2.8K21

    Dash学习记录1

    Dash是用于构建Web分析应用程序的高效Python框架。...Dash是写在Flask,Plotly.js和React.js之上,是使用纯Python的高度自定义用户界面构建数据可视化应用程序的理想选择。它特别适合使用Python处理数据的任何人。...通过几个简单的模式,Dash提取了构建基于Web的交互式应用程序所需的所有技术和协议。 Dash非常简单,仅仅需要一个下午写Python代码就可以完成。 Dash应用程序在Web浏览器中呈现。...可以将应用程序部署到服务器,然后通过URL共享它们。由于Dash应用程序是在Web浏览器中查看的,因此Dash本质上是跨平台且可移动的。Dash是一个开放源代码库,根据许可的MIT许可证发布。...dash安装 pip install dash==1.19.0 dash布局 Dash应用程序由两部分组成。第一部分是应用程序的“布局”,它描述了应用程序的外观。第二部分描述了应用程序的交互性。

    3K30

    如何移除或禁用 Ubuntu Dock

    Ubuntu Dock - 屏幕左侧栏,可用于固定应用程序或访问已安装的应用程序。使用默认的 Ubuntu 会话时,无法使用 Gnome Tweaks 禁用它(禁用无效)。...但是如果你需要,还是有几种方法来摆脱它的。下面我将列出 4 种方法可以移除或禁用 Ubuntu Dock,以及每个方法的缺点(如果有的话),还有如何撤销每个方法的更改。...如何在没有 Ubuntu Dock 的情况下访问活动概览 如果没有 Ubuntu Dock,你可能无法访问活动的或已安装的应用程序列表(可以通过单击 Dock 底部的“显示应用程序”按钮从 Ubuntu...显然,如果你安装了 Dash to Panel 扩展来替代 Ubuntu Dock,那么还好。因为 Dash to Panel 提供了一个按钮来访问活动概览或已安装的应用程序。...你可以使用 Gnome Tweaks 应用程序轻松更改 Gtk 和图标主题。

    6.6K10

    MPEG最近在忙啥?

    MPEG-4 ISO / IEC 14496视听对象的编码是一个34部分标准,可以在固定和移动网络上大规模使用媒体。 Open Font Format的第1修正案将支持复杂的布局和新的布局功能。...在制作第7版之后,MPEG正在进行两项修订,以承载两种不同类型的内容: JPEG XS(低延迟应用程序的JPEG标准) CMAF(MPEG应用格式) MPEG-4 第12部分基于ISO的媒体文件格式是另一个非常活跃的工作领域...在MPEG-B中,MPEG正在制定两个新标准: 第14部分的部分文件格式将提供一种标准机制,用于在广播应用程序中存储HTTP实体和部分文件,以用于以后的缓存填充。...MPEG-DASH MPEG正在努力: 第1部分媒体演示文稿描述和段格式正在通过设备信息和其他扩展修订进行增强。FDAM计划于2019年7月达成。...MPEG正在制定两个新标准: 第21部分视觉识别管理应用程序格式将提供一个框架,用于管理出现在用户之间共享的图片或视频上的用户的隐私。FDIS预计将于2019年1月达成。

    1.8K40

    开源库 Taipy 将 AI 算法、数据转化为 Web 应用程序

    我们在外观和感觉方面的主要优势在于布局:我们提供简单的语法来定制应用程序的设计,我们还有一个 VS Code 扩展,它允许你在不运行 Python 代码的情况下预览页面的设计。”...她承认,虽然该库是可定制的,但她表示,“默认布局和外观可能不如其他不太可定制的库令人印象深刻。”...例如,你可以从 Taipy 界面更改模型参数,使用按钮运行模型,并在 Taipy 网页中可视化结果。” 它还提供允许用户实时可视化和交互大型数据集的功能。...目标:易用性加上可扩展性 我们还询问了 Taipy 与其他类似框架(例如 Streamlit、Dash 或 Flask)相比如何。...“另一方面,Dash 等工具具有可扩展性,但学习曲线陡峭。我们看到了市场的空白,并抓住了它。”

    36810

    深挖 Threads App 帖子布局,我进一步加深了对CSS网格布局的理解

    使用CSS Grid进行帖子布局 在生产应用程序中,CSS Grid的最显着的用例之一就是Threads。CSS Grid用于构建帖子布局。...我尝试复制网格并基于命名区域构建它。与指定列和行的值相比,它看起来更容易扫描。...SVG细线处理 说实话,最初吸引我注意的是Threads应用程序中的线条。我对它的构造方式感到好奇,因为几周前我曾写过一个类似的主题。...网格的内联CSS变量 我很高兴看到像Threads这样的大型应用程序正在使用我和许多其他人提倡的东西。 在用户个人资料中,选项卡网格布局是使用包含选项卡数的内联CSS变量构建的。 很有用。...我仍然没有发现使用break-word和anywhere之间的区别。如果Threads团队中有任何人正在阅读这篇文章,我非常好奇为什么。

    17820

    EME WTF? 加密媒体扩展介绍

    请注意,CDM和许可证服务器之间可能存在多个消息,并且此过程中的所有通信对浏览器和应用程序都是不透明的:消息只能由CDM和许可证服务器理解,但应用程序层可以看到什么类型的消息CDM正在发送。...根据webm_crypt说明,可以为WebM完成对Clear Key使用的视频加密。商业服务也是可用的(至少对于ISO BMFF / MP4)并且正在开发其他解决方案。...这可以被认为是一个标题,包含关于编码,帧大小等的信息。 总结: 媒体以不同的比特率进行编码。 不同的比特率文件可从HTTP服务器获得。 客户端网络应用程序选择要使用DASH检索和回放的比特率。...在JavaScript中实现DASH允许自适应算法在不需要浏览器更新的情况下发展。使用MSE还可以实现替代清单格式和传送机制,而无需更改浏览器。...结论 利用网络提供付费视频和音频的速度正在加快。看起来,每个新设备,无论是平板电脑,游戏机,连接电视还是机顶盒,都能够通过HTTP从主要内容提供商流媒体。

    2.1K60
    领券